Blackstone to Buy Data-Center Operator QTS Realty Trust for $6.7 Billion

Blackstone Group Inc. has struck a roughly $6.7 billion deal to
buy QTS Realty Trust Inc. and take the data-center operator
private.
The investment giant's infrastructure unit, Blackstone
Infrastructure Partners, together with its nontraded real-estate
investment trust, known as BREIT, have agreed to pay $78 a share
for QTS, the companies plan to announce Monday. The price
represents a 21% premium to QTS's closing share price Friday and a
24% premium to the volume-weighted average over the last 90
days.
Including the assumption of QTS's existing debt, the transaction
is valued at about $10 billion.
Based in Overland Park, Kansas, QTS is a real-estate investment
trust that owns more than 7 million square feet of data-center
space in 28 locations across North America and Europe. Its
customers include big software and social-media companies as well
as government entities that use the centers to securely store and
process data.
Blackstone's thematic approach to investing under President
Jonathan Gray has led it to plow more money into fast-growing areas
of the economy including technology companies and warehouses used
in e-commerce. Buying QTS will give it exposure to another hot
sector as data use continues to grow rapidly. The firm plans to own
the QTS platform for longer than the typical private-equity
investment and to continue to expand its capabilities and reach,
according to people familiar with the matter.
The infrastructure business and BREIT, a vehicle targeted at
moderately wealthy individuals, are what Blackstone calls
"perpetual" capital. That means they can hold assets indefinitely
and don't have to return capital to investors within a set period
like the typical private-equity or real-estate fund.
